The Opportunity

We are currently accepting applications for an innovative, detail-oriented, resourceful person to manage departmental operations related to data management in support of fund development and community relations.  Reporting to the Director of Advancement, this individual must be extremely fluent in operating and populating Raiser’s Edge NXT as they are responsible for the day-to-day administration, management, and growth of the database in support of all development activities.

 

This role is key to developing the success and sustainability of the Raiser’s Edge database while also elevating the work and execution of fund development activities – specifically related to prospect management, predictive modelling, and donor engagement.

 

Key Responsibilities

  • Oversee data management in Raiser’s Edge. This includes gift entry (donations, sponsorships, Gift-In-Kind), general data entry, processing donations and sponsorships in collaboration with the Financial Edge module, tax receipting, acknowledgements, stewardship, proposal set up and tracking moves management, analysis of data, producing prospect research profiles, sorting data, reporting data and generating queries and lists for various purposes (appeals, communications, events, etc.).
  • Design data tracking and monitoring tools, including custom reports when necessary (crystal reports). Example: Portfolio Balance Reports to ensure donor pipeline health and sustainability.
  • Attend relevant meetings as the Raiser’s Edge expert.
  • Take an integrated approach to seeking out relevant information and working with multiple school departments to ensure data is effectively analyzed, synthesized, and distributed to both internal and external stakeholders when appropriate.
  • Manage gift batch creation and review batches for accuracy, including accurate coding of campaign, fund, appeal, package, acknowledgement, and tax receipt.
  • Set up and manage events in Raiser’s Edge for various School Fundraisers.
  • Prepare weekly and monthly donation reports, including reports for Board of Governors.
  • Tracking and reporting school volunteers in Raiser’s Edge.
  • Complete month end and fiscal year-end reconciliation between Raiser’s Edge NXT module and Financial Edge module, streamline this process during the system transition.
  • Assist with the assessment of data against fund development plans and help recommend adjustments to activity and targets as appropriate. An example of this is analyzing the prospect management/clearance system to ensure Development staff are working with a robust gift pipeline.
  • Maintain a high level of data integrity, including merging duplicate records and regularly running queries to flag data issues and update accordingly.
  • Work closely with Development staff in identifying and researching prospects and donors, including sponsors for events. This includes working with the iWave database.
  • Assist the Director of Advancement in maintaining Development processes, policies, and procedures.
  • Assist in developing content for briefing notes for prospect/donor meetings, as well as for meetings with senior staff and volunteers.
  • Ability to manage Advancement Office Purchase Orders and ensure budget controls are followed.
  • Management of Annual Fund Requests - seeking approvals, tracking, and reporting.
  • Organize meetings and book facilities, refreshments, prepare handouts or reports, record meeting minutes, from time to time.

Qualifications and Experience

  • 5-10 years experience with full responsibility for Raiser’s Edge in a not-for-profit organization preferred.
  • Experience working as part of a fundraising team.
  • A bachelor’s degree and/or a professional qualification in a data management field is desired.
  • Understanding of CRA regulations for recording and receipting of charitable donations.
  • Strong computer skills including a high level of proficiency in Microsoft Office tools.
